Yellow (Mountain) Saxifrage

Saxifraga aizoides L.

Sarah Gregg   cc-by-nc-sa

Saxifraga aizoides (Yellow (Mountain) Saxifrage) is a species of perennial herb in the family Saxifragaceae. They have a self-supporting growth form. They are native to The Contiguous United States, Alaska, Greenland, and Canada. They have simple, broad leaves and loculicidal capsule fruit. Flowers are visited by Limnophyes ninae, Alliopsis glacialis, Megaselia groenlandica, and Smittia aterrima. Individuals can grow to 0.068 m.
